Transaction f7e76c112b42141b969af328351a32ed830f672e0cc99c9015f636552080651a

1 Input
2 Outputs
  • f7e76c112b42141b969af328351a32ed830f672e0cc99c9015f636552080651a:0
  • value  13857176
    address  3QJFy42JGo2MrMvGdU2DckAvaadpRP3Wtu
  • f7e76c112b42141b969af328351a32ed830f672e0cc99c9015f636552080651a:1
  • value  81566
    address  3KJ6NVy5qhVUqttiGfHZGhXR7v2yxLGCPQ